Tooling Technician (2nd Shift)

PCC Talent Acquisition PortalEastlake, OH
Onsite

About The Position

Join a High-Performance Manufacturing Team. We are looking for a Tooling Technician to support injection operations by ensuring tooling is clean, functional, and production-ready. This role is critical in reducing downtime, supporting production flow, and maintaining high-quality standards in a fast-paced manufacturing environment. If you enjoy hands-on mechanical work, problem-solving, and keeping production running smoothly, this is the role for you. This is a 2nd Shift position, Monday–Friday, 2:00 PM – 10:00 PM at the Eastlake Facility.

Responsibilities

  • Respond quickly to tooling and production issues to minimize downtime
  • Assist with die setups, changeovers, and production readiness
  • Clean, inspect, and prepare tooling during production stoppages
  • Identify and document tooling needing repair or maintenance
  • Communicate issues with supervisors, leads, and engineering teams
  • Support operators with proper tooling care and maintenance
  • Inspect parts for quality and ensure compliance standards are met
  • Maintain 6S organization and safety standards
  • Track tooling activity using Gage Track system
  • Disassemble, clean, troubleshoot, and reassemble dies
